New 360 Play family entertainment centre opens in Farnborough, UK

After two successful ‘Golden Ticket’ preview days 360 Play Farnborough opened its doors to the public on Wednesday 18th October.

Managing director Duncan Phillips who was on hand with the new 360 Play team said: “We are delighted to open our newest family entertainment centre at The Meads Shopping Centre here in Farnborough, our sixth UK venue. On Wednesday Deputy Mayor Cllr Steve Masterson was present to officially open the new centre which as well as using local contractors for the build has also created 40 new jobs.

Among the attractions are a three storey central play structure, a dodgem car track, a carousel and the creative play area 360 Street, where youngsters are able to let their imaginations run wild in a series of play shops and other ‘buildings,’ including a supermarket, pizza parlour, vet’s, fire station, garage and more. A special party zone and dedicated toddlers’ area are also on offer, along with a café and plenty of comfortable seating.

Everything at 360 Play is carefully designed so that mums and dads can join in with their children, a key element of the philosophy of the owners who recognise the importance of adults being involved in their youngsters’ play activities.
